Tribal Court Authorities: The Foundation of Court Governance

Tribal court administrators are responsible for the operation and management of the tribal court, in accordance with the tribe’s laws, rules and other authorities in place. Court administrators are also responsible for ensuring the court staff is performing tasks in a uniform and consistent manner, also in accordance with the tribe’s laws, rules and other authorities in place. This session provides an overview of the importance of tribal court authorities, defines tribal court authorities that can govern the court and examines the significance of the court authorities’ effects on the positions of the court administrator and court staff.

Objectives

  • Give a general overview of the importance in knowing the tribal court authorities that govern the court
  • Define the tribal court authorities that can govern the court
  • Examine the significance of the tribal court authorities’ effects on the positions of the court administrator and court staff
